A driver struck and killed Brian Devin Coulson walking on Lancaster Drive last night. It was on the stretch of Lancaster just north of Sunnyview, and near McKay High School, where drivers have killed other people in the last couple of years.
From Salem PD today:
At approximately 11:30 p.m. on Thursday, January 16, officers responded to the report of an injured man in the roadway in the 2000 block of Lancaster DR NE. Paramedics performed lifesaving measures, but the pedestrian was ultimately pronounced deceased at the scene.
The preliminary report by the Salem Police Traffic Team indicates the driver was traveling southbound on Lancaster DR, south of Beverly AV NE when the victim was struck. The driver continued southbound with the victim separating from the vehicle after several blocks. The driver did not stop and left the area.
The victim of the hit-and-run collision is identified as 55-year-old Brian Devin Coulson of Salem.
Officers searched the area and at approximately 12:20 a.m. located the involved vehicle and driver in the vicinity of Cordon and Silverton RDS NE. The suspect is identified as 35-year-old Sergio Aguilar of Gervais.
Aguilar was taken into custody and lodged at the Marion County Jail on the following charges:
Manslaughter, second degree
Reckless driving
Reckless endangering
Failure to perform the duties of a driver
Driving under the influence of an intoxicant
